news 2026/2/8 4:22:24

视频播放器控件全功能测试方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
视频播放器控件全功能测试方案

一、核心功能测试模块

  1. 基础交互验证

    • 播放控制:测试播放/暂停/停止功能在单次操作、连续操作及与其他功能(如音量调节)并发时的响应逻辑。

    • 进度控制:验证进度条拖拽、快进/快退(含倍速切换)的精确性,重点检查拖拽后音画同步和缓冲机制。

    • 列表管理:

      • 默认列表加载逻辑(来源识别、条目数量限制)

      • 列表编辑(增删视频、跨存储介质操作)

      • 列表异常处理(文件失效、格式不支持)

  2. 高级功能测试

    | 功能类型 | 测试场景 | 验证要点 | |----------------|---------------------------|------------------------------| | 播放模式 | 单循环/列表循环/随机播放 | 模式切换后播放顺序逻辑一致性 | | 多窗口交互 | 全屏/画中画/分屏切换 | 控件适配性与状态同步 | | 记忆功能 | 中断恢复(杀进程/断网) | 进度还原精度与列表完整性 |
  3. 异常与边界测试

    • 格式兼容性:注入非常规编码文件(如破损MP4、非常用编码WebM)验证崩溃风险

    • 资源极限测试:

      • 大文件(4K/8K)加载时长阈值(建议≤2s)

      • 低内存场景下播放稳定性(内存泄漏检测)

    • 网络自适应:模拟弱网环境(3G/丢包率30%)检查卡顿处理与自动降级策略

二、专项测试策略

  1. 自动化测试框架

    • 单元测试:覆盖控制器状态机(播放/暂停/错误),分支覆盖率需≥90%

    • UI自动化:

      # 伪代码示例:播放中断恢复测试 def test_playback_resume(): launch_app() play_video("test.mp4") simulate_process_kill() # 模拟杀进程 restart_app() assert playback_position == previous_position ±500ms # 容错阈值
    • 持续集成:每日构建中触发核心用例(播放控制、列表加载)

  2. 兼容性测试矩阵

    维度

    测试范围

    操作系统

    Android 10-14, iOS 15-17

    分辨率

    720p/1080p/4K/折叠屏模式

    外设支持

    蓝牙遥控/游戏手柄/语音输入

三、验收标准与质量度量

  • 关键指标

    • 功能通过率:100%核心用例(播放/暂停/列表加载)

    • 崩溃率:<0.1%(Crash-free sessions)

    • 性能:首帧加载≤1.5s(4G网络)

  • 缺陷管理:建立控制器专项缺陷看板,重点跟踪状态同步类问题

精选文章:

‌医疗电子皮肤生理信号采集准确性测试报告

智慧法院电子卷宗检索效率测试:技术指南与优化策略

‌DeFi借贷智能合约漏洞扫描测试:软件测试从业者指南

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/7 6:00:29

医疗系统多表单连续操作测试方案

医疗信息系统&#xff08;如HIS、EMR&#xff09;常涉及挂号→问诊→检查→处方→结算的多表单串联操作。本文针对此类场景构建覆盖全链路的测试方案&#xff0c;重点解决数据一致性、状态流转及异常中断三大核心问题。 一、测试目标分层设计 功能连贯性验证 跨表单数据继承&a…

作者头像 李华
网站建设 2026/2/7 3:38:54

Java springboot基于Android的校园服务系统失物招领二手闲置跑腿代购(源码+文档+运行视频+讲解视频)

文章目录 系列文章目录前言一、开发介绍二、详细视频演示三、项目部分实现截图 四、uniapp介绍 五、系统测试 六、代码参考 源码获取 目的 基于Android的校园服务系统整合失物招领、二手闲置交易、跑腿代购等功能&#xff0c;采用Spring Boot框架构建后端服务&#xff0c;My…

作者头像 李华
网站建设 2026/2/7 5:59:30

AI写论文必知!4款AI论文生成工具,为你的论文创作保驾护航!

在2025年&#xff0c;学术写作迎来了智能化的浪潮&#xff0c;越来越多的人开始尝试使用AI写论文的工具。当涉及到硕士和博士等长篇论文时&#xff0c;许多工具却表现不佳。它们往往缺乏理论的深度&#xff0c;或者逻辑结构显得松散&#xff0c;不能满足专业论文写作的需求。普…

作者头像 李华
网站建设 2026/2/5 11:21:10

超实用!AI教材生成工具,快速编写低查重教材,轻松搞定教学难题

AI 教材写作工具&#xff1a;助力高效教材创作 在编写教材的过程中&#xff0c;我总是能精准感受到“缓慢进展”所带来的各种困扰。就算框架和资料准备得相当充分&#xff0c;内容撰写时却常常陷入瓶颈——有一句话反复修改半个小时&#xff0c;依旧觉得没有找到合适的表达&am…

作者头像 李华